Select all the correct answers. What were the main points of Wegener's hypothesis about continental drift? All pieces of land on Earth were once joined together. Earth's surface is covered with continental plates. All the continents are moving at a slow pace. Earth must have formed billions of years ago.​

Answer:

All pieces of land on Earth were once joined together.

All the continents are moving at a slow pace.
